What is the feature of technology?

Compared to alternative methods of drilling and cutting building materials, diamond technology has two fundamental points. This primarily relates to the quality of the holes and openings formed. This feature is due to the use of special bits and crowns that carefully invade the structure of the material, making accurate and at the same time fast cutting. The second feature is the cleanliness that remains after diamond drilling of holes in the concrete has been completed. The technology provides for the inclusion in the working process of a cooling system of cutting elements by means of water. But, in addition to the function of a cooler, this device also performs a filtering role, instantly eliminating dust that is formed during drilling. Water is supplied through a pump or a special tank. In a cleanroom environment, an industrial vacuum cleaner and sludge collector may be used to ensure this.

Where is diamond concrete drilling used?

This cutting method can be used in the construction of private houses, and in reconstruction works, as well as in technical measures of an industrial scale. That is, in all areas where, in principle, drilling or cutting of concrete structures may be required. For example, the widespread work can include staking the foundation for the purpose of conducting ventilation ducts, installing fire lines in the ceilings, fixing fencing elements, etc. Diamond drilling of holes in concrete is often used as part of renewal projects for electric networks. For such operations, hand tools with a small diameter are used. However, in the creation of openings for engineering communications in heating and gas supply systems, large-format nozzles cannot be dispensed with.

Diamond cutting equipment

Use for the implementation of diamond processing can only be a special tool. Usually professional builders use whole complexes of machine tools and units. In any case, the main functions fall on the basic installation, which provides drive force. Crowns, in turn, directly realize diamond drilling of concrete. The equipment of this type is a core drill, which is driven by a unit equipped with a hydraulic or electric grinder.

Hydraulic machines designed for drilling holes with large diameters are quite common. The most powerful equipment of this type resembles industrial units in design and construction. This is due to the requirements for energy supply, and with the technical device of the machine itself. Almost any diamond concrete drilling machine is equipped with a bed, which allows you to attach the base structure to the work area. As for the power of the equipment, it varies on average from 1.5 to 3 kW. The most productive plants are three-phase models, which include water-cooled induction motors.

Operational technical support

First of all, drilling operations are impossible without the use of diamond segments. These are high-strength gear elements with diamond impregnations that allow you to handle a wide range of building materials. In shape, this equipment can be represented by discs and ropes with a cutting edge. Diamond drilling of concrete is also possible without reliable fixation of equipment. It has already been noted that for this purpose the installations are equipped with special devices. The operator at the place of work must properly secure the bed with anchor elements or dowels.

Also, the working process is impossible without a source of water and electrical wiring. As a rule, such a tool is powered from a 220 V network, although industrial units require a higher voltage. In accordance with the technology, diamond drilling of holes in concrete is carried out according to the โ€œwetโ€ method, that is, it is important to calculate a sufficient supply of water for the full service of the procedure. So, for example, for drilling a wall with a 10-centimeter diameter to a depth of 50 cm, approximately 5 liters are consumed.

Crown Selection Options

Practice shows that the quality of the gating is affected not so much by the power of the equipment and the skills of the operator, but by the correspondence of the selected crown to the requirements of the task. Of course, you should take into account all the nuances and installation conditions, but the factor of the choice of equipment directly determines the final result. So, crowns are selected according to criteria such as abrasion, reinforcement and diameter. Depending on the sizes with which it is planned to carry out diamond drilling of concrete, not only the diameter of the nozzle is selected, but also the degree of granularity of the cutting chips. Abrasiveness also affects the quality of drilling. The best option may be to use different devices. If you plan to create a large hole in a thick wall, then the main operation of the strobing is carried out with a coarse-grained crown, and then its result is adjusted by a less rigid abrasive. It is necessary to take into account the need for reinforcing the working element, although modern devices are almost never produced without additional strengthening of the structure.

Wire cutting technology

This is a rather specific type of diamond cutting, in the implementation of which not crowns are used, but a rope with working segments fixed on its surface. The technical support of this technique involves the use of machines with electric motors and wheel locks that implement the belt travel. The user can use the drive speed controls to select the optimal cutting parameters, as well as use automatic modes. Unfortunately, diamond cutting of concrete by wire is not always possible due to the large size of the equipment. In places where it was possible to implement this technology, there is a high cutting speed and silent operation of the units. By the way, the equipment itself wears less during operation.

How much does diamond drilling cost?

In terms of cost of processing, concrete is not the most expensive material. Usually in price lists it is placed between reinforced concrete and brick. The specific rates depend on many parameters, but the diameter is considered the main one. The general calculation is based on the depth at which the holes in the concrete are formed. Prices per 1 cm average 40-50 rubles. At the same time, a small diameter of 30 mm can cost 15 rubles, and for a 350 mm hole they ask about 100 rubles.
